Children Sledding with Snowman

Make this Christmas season a homemade season with all your decorating ideas. Make a winter wonderland with some kids and a snowman sledding down the hill. Acrylics paint the picture.

Materials:

  • Americana Acrylics
    • DAO1 - Snow (Titanium) White
    • DAO46 - Sea Aqua
    • DAO64 - Burnt UmbeDAO67 - Lamp (Ebony) Black
    • DA170 - Santa Red
    • DA113 - Plantation Pine
    • DA168 - Golden Straw
    • DAO78 - Flesh Tone
    • DA196 - Tangelo Orange
    • DA235 - Citron Green
  • Dazzling Metallics
    • DAO70 - Shimmering Silver
  • Americana Spray Sealers
    • DAS13 - Americana Matte Spray
  • Winter Wonderland Kit
    • DASK220 - Americana Winter Wonderland Kit (paints included)
  • Don Mechanic plaster figure of children and snowman on sled

Steps:

  1. Paint as follows: snowman, hat fur, back jacket buttons, and snow, Snow White; faces, Flesh Tone; front hat and back jacket, Hauser Dark Green.
     
  2. Paint front slacks, snowman hat, and back hat, True Blue; paint snowman scarf and sled top, Santa Red.
     
  3. Mix Citron Green and True Blue and paint mixture on front scarf, mittens, and back slacks.
     
  4. Mix Golden Straw and Burnt Umber and paint mixture on shoes and hair.
     
  5. Use Lamp Black on sled runners, snowman eyes, mouth, and buttons.
     
  6. Paint boy's eyes with Burnt Umber and Snow White.
     
  7. Snowman's nose is Tangelo Orange; blush all faces with mix of Flesh Tone and Santa Red.
     
  8. Let all dry completely. Seal with Americana Matte Spray. Let dry.
     
  9. Antique with Lamp Black. Dry brush sled runners with Shimmering Silver.
